    H olly Hill Inn’s historic Greek revival building in Midway, Kentucky, was a home and country inn before opening as a fine dining restaurant in 2001.

    Owner Chef Ouita Michel was one of the first to elevate the bounty of Kentucky through farm-to-table cuisine. Many of the herbs and vegetables served spring from the restaurant’s own on-site garden and menu descriptions celebrate the farm of origin for artisanal-quality ingredients. The Inn serves a seasonal prix fixe menu for dinner and brunch and limits reservations to ensure leisurely dining so that guests have a table that is theirs for the duration of the meal.

    Baked goods come from the restaurant’s own Midway Bakery across town. Try the salty-and-sweet combo of tender buttermilk biscuits layered with shaved smoky country ham and housemade apple butter. The creamiest cheese grits you will ever have, ground by fourth-generation Weisenberger Mills, are slow-cooked with sharp cheddar and a cayenne zing, and the simple but addictive (cucumbers, cream cheese) Benedictine spread moves up and down the menu, as a sandwich spread, filling for cherry tomatoes, and topping for salmon croquettes.

    No proper Kentucky-centric menu is complete without featuring its native spirit. The Inn’s bourbon library has more than 100 offerings, and bourbon balls, crafted by confectioner Ruth Hunt Candies , are the perfect way to close your meal.
